CONCEPT SKETCHES - EYEWEAR

These sketches were a deliberate break from briefs and constraints.  The goal was to treat eyewear as a canvas for absurdist product thinking: borrowing shapes from car interiors, food packaging, plumbing, and nature, then forcing them into wearable (or gloriously unwearable) frame silhouettes.  A few of these might actually work.  Most of them shouldn't.  That's the point.

Software Used : Photoshop, Solidworks, & 3D Printing/Sculpy
